DVD Reviews of Run Ronnie Run!

DVD Review: Hmm...i dunno...
Summary: 2 Stars

I was excited when i heard Bob and David say they were making this film on Dennis Miller live. I mean those two are some of the funniest guys out there, their show "Mr. Show" was an absolute brilliant piece of work. For some reason, the film was still in the "shooting" stage for several years. Once it was done it was never released in theatres, aside from being shown at the cannes film festival. I often wondered why it never came out....until i saw it.

I wasnt exactly sure how how i'd describe this film until i told my brother about it. He and i both being huge Mr. Show fans. When i told him just about everything about the film he said "So....it's one of those films that has some funny stuff in it but it'd otherwise kind of hard to watch?"

Yeah that about sums it up.

About the biggest problem with the film is the Ronnie Dobbs character himself. In the Mr. Show episodes he was a low class, angry, violent, idiotic, self-centered a-hole. However, that really is what makes him funny. The film sort of tones that side of him down and tries to create a sort of sweet side to him, to make him more appealing i suppose. Ronnie has some sort of crush on some trailer park chick named tammy (no, its really not as funny as it sounds). You might remember tammy from a few scenes in Mr. Show. One scene where she's ratting him out to the cops as he shouts "Lying B$%ch!" over and over. Another where he meets up with her after being and jail, and noticing that she's pregnent remarks "Ok who you been F#&$ing? It travis?"

While thats not nice stuff to say, for some reason its halarious to see that complete lack of empathy. Which is, once again, the ronnie dobbs charm. No such luck in this movie though. He's quite tame in his remarks and actions, he basically spends most of the film trying to win tammy. Wasnt that the plot to Joe dirt? And didnt joe dirt show that you cant really have a low class, idiotic, self centered a-hole who's also lovable? One or the other here fellas.

I only saw one small scene in the movie where i actually recognized the Mr. Show character. After becoming rich and famous, but still not attaining tammy, he thinks of an idea to make her jealous by introducing her to the beer model he's been dating. The plan backfires and ronnie just upsets both women. After tammy leaves, upset, ronnie remarks to the beer model "way to go b&^ch, you blew it". She slaps him and leaves as well. Thats about all you can expect in the ways of a Mr. Show ronnie.

There are lots of surprisingly funny scenes, one involving R. Lee Ermy and a fat kid and others with the pop group "three times one minus one", but i'd say about 50% of the film is just dead air. There's scenes that sort of try to be funny, but just come off as dumb or banal, or even just weird. such as ronnie meets a korean kid in a wheelchair who has some sort of terminal foot disorder and needs some kind of special shoes. For some reason...david's voice is dubbed over the kids. But even more strage is that Ronnie just starts wistfully dreaming out loud about the things he'd do to keep the kid from getting his special shoes. It comes off as odd seeing how much work they put into making ronnie some kind of lovable guy.

The basic plot is bizarre. You can tell an entire team of writers were working on it and pieced their work together in some sort of shoddy, hacked together final draft. All in all the story could of been told in about a half hour. You can basically tell how it's going to end about 10 minutes into the film.

All in all, my brother said it best. Theres funny stuff yeah....but you'll find yourself wandering into other rooms to do things while watching this film; or wearing out your fast forward button.
